Waukesha weather in March

In March, Waukesha sees average daytime highs of 43°F and overnight lows near 28°F, with 2.3 in of precipitation across 9.3 wet days and about 11.6 hours of daylight. It is the 9th-warmest and 8th-wettest month of the year here.

Highs climb over the month, from about 37°F in the first days to 49°F by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 24% of the time in March,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 10 h 54 min at the start of March to 12 h 24 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, March is Waukesha's 7th-clearest and 7th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Waukesha's year-round climate.

Temperature in March

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Highs climb over the month, from about 37°F in the first days to 49°F by the end.

A typical March day in Waukesha reaches about 43°F in the afternoon and slips back to 28°F overnight — a 16°F sp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 30°F and 59°F. Set against its neighbours, March runs about 11°F warmer than February and about 12°F cooler than April.

Location & terrain

Where is Waukesha?

Waukesha sits at 43.0°N, 88.2°W, 814 ft above sea level, in United States. The nearest listed city is New Berlin, 6.8 mi away.

Topography around Waukesha

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 2, 10 and 50 miles of Waukesha.

Within 2 miles, the terrain around Waukesha has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 285 ft around an average of 883 ft above sea level; within 10 miles,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 561 ft; within 50 miles,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 846 ft.

The land around Waukesha is covered by artificial surfaces (49%) and trees (33%) within 2 miles, trees (46%) and grassland (28%) within 10 miles, and cropland (34%), water (27%) and trees (21%) within 50 miles.
